We are seeking 2 full-time positions: a Project Landscape Architect – Project Manager and a Project Landscape Designer. These positions are hybrid (3 days in-office/2 days remote). You will be involved with a wide variety of projects such as education (K-12) campuses, parks/playgrounds, sports/recreational facilities, municipal, and multi-family housing.
Project Landscape Architect - Project Manager
Key Responsibilities:
• Lead and manage landscape design efforts from concept to completion.
• Prepare and review design plans, construction documents, and planting plans.
• Manage project budgets, schedules, and client deliverables.
• Mentor and train junior staff, fostering their professional development.
• Build and maintain strong client relationships, ensuring successful project outcomes.
• Attend meetings, conduct site visits, and perform construction administration duties.
Required Skills & Qualifications:
• Bachelor's or Master's degree in Landscape Architecture and a PLA license.
• Minimum of 5 years of experience in landscape architecture with construction administration experience.
• Strong proficiency in AutoCAD and Adobe Suite.
• Excellent organizational, communication, and project management skills.
• Ability to mentor staff and develop client relationships.
Project Landscape Designer
Key Responsibilities:
• Prepare various exhibits, presentation graphics and renderings
• Prepare schematic landscape design and planting plans, and tree preservation plans
• Complete site visits and tree assessments (local plant knowledge is an asset)
• Assist with the preparation of construction documents, details and specifications
• Attend project meetings with senior staff
Required Skills & Qualifications:
• Bachelor's or Master's degree in Landscape Architecture, Planning, or equivalent
• Minimum of 3 years of relevant design experience
• Strong proficiency in AutoCAD and Adobe Suite.
• Good organizational skills to manage priorities and deadlines
